Transactions 

June 5, 1989: Drafted by the Boston Red Sox in the 10th round of the 1989 amateur draft. Player signed June 22, 1989.

July 27, 1990: Traded by the Boston Red Sox with a player to be named later and Ed Perozo (minors) to the New York Mets for Mike Marshall. The Boston Red Sox sent Paul Williams (minors) (November 19, 1990) to the New York Mets to complete the trade.

December 15, 1990: Traded by the New York Mets with Bob Ojeda to the Los Angeles Dodgers for Hubie Brooks.

July 31, 1995: Traded by the Los Angeles Dodgers with a player to be named later, Ron Coomer, and Jose Parra to the Minnesota Twins for Kevin Tapani and Mark Guthrie. The Los Angeles Dodgers sent Chris Latham (October 30, 1995) to the Minnesota Twins to complete the trade.

October 11, 1996: Selected off waivers by the Boston Red Sox from the Minnesota Twins.

March 26, 1997: Released by the Boston Red Sox.

March 31, 1997: Signed as a Free Agent with the Milwaukee Brewers.

October 15, 1997: Granted Free Agency.

December 18, 1997: Signed as a Free Agent with the Arizona Diamondbacks.

March 25, 1998: Released by the Arizona Diamondbacks.

March 31, 1998: Signed as a Free Agent with the Oakland Athletics.

May 9, 1998: Sent by the Oakland Athletics to the Kansas City Royals to complete an earlier deal made on April 8, 1998. The Oakland Athletics sent a player to be named later and Shane Mack to the Kansas City Royals for Mike Macfarlane. The Oakland Athletics sent Greg Hansell (May 9, 1998) to the Kansas City Royals to complete the trade.

October 15, 1998: Granted Free Agency.

December 4, 1998: Signed as a Free Agent with the San Francisco Giants.

April 2, 1999: Released by the San Francisco Giants.

April 7, 1999: Signed as a Free Agent with the Pittsburgh Pirates.

December 7, 1999: Purchased by the Hanshin Tigers (Japan Central) from the Pittsburgh Pirates.

March 24, 2003: Signed as a Free Agent with the New York Yankees.

October 15, 2003: Granted Free Agency.

July 30, 2004: Signed as a Free Agent with the Arizona Diamondbacks.

October 15, 2004: Granted Free Agency.
